Biography

George Lane Cooper, also known as George Cooper or George Lane-Cooper, was born on January 28, 1934, in England, UK. He was a versatile actor known for his roles in several notable films. Cooper's career spanned over two decades, with his first credited role in the 1980 film "Superman II," where he worked as a stunt performer. He gained recognition for his acting skills in the 1989 film "Batman," portraying the character of a Goon. Cooper's final film appearance was in "The Three Musketeers" in 1993, where he played the uncredited role of the Executioner. He passed away on January 1, 2006.
